Seminars in Bordeaux
City of art, business and history, Bordeaux is on the List of UNESCO since 2007. It is the capital of Aquitaine and it lives on the rhythm of the new century without disavowing his penchant for culture, gastronomy, nature and everything that makes a business trip an enjoyable moment ...
